Type
ORACLE
Validation date
2024-04-02 12:34: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 0.035,
    "usd": 0.03762
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001306E557329FFB7C78518CA3757DA48B0D0DACE6F569694D7C956787175EAE3CB

Previous signature

FE70838AF4A511F9C26B4F281590DFC595EBF249C466D4769766DE5D1814D7FB86B8BA15CD4D502539C757FDE6A496B94EB20FED1CD671B4CB36C7888FBCEA02

Origin signature

304402200441289F436FF189DC78F0D4B6729A3F2485AE39768A33354CBC66BCF6AA177802201A28BF856C41A0B2D799F8A77ED76D5226B35075F786688D1D8F0EDD0EEF2A72

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

006BBBB75CC0F61EF4135A4ADFC5B63C9CD66A92F9F7958EB178BA54A6D0657B07

Coordinator signature

5F6ED3114045BCBBAB4B4B8E9B630B3E3CA1E1D27169DAEF193B11C5E3969D9325EB989A013F8A15EECCBA37432B2DBE1534C0434719F4B085E1D8B798F3500C

Validator #1 public key

000177BA744AC778DC2D51A1B7C622E7AC4BD1E1AA8DA2D0FCE71BAAB7DAD0E020E0

Validator #1 signature

6CF244F70EE7DFBC750A04DADE4B281CEBB0A00790266CAEFFC3ACA047A3D204097BAE0FB07C3BDC680EE9B2C822ECB6B51F2DDCE713CE2A51860FB2857DB302

Validator #2 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#2 signature

A86E9B48AF22A1B4E456FD37947BE1AEBAACEBCA721FAF9CF0E272BA1DCBFF63981D9E79FBA25AB3BBBFBC9269E052F661D7CBFAD9A8F9B38864D248D2059202